Real Madrid Confirms Key Player Futures Amid Club World Cup Transition

News summary

Real Madrid is actively planning its future under new head coach Xabi Alonso, focusing on integrating key players like Jesús Fortea, Rodrygo, and Dani Ceballos. Fortea, a teenage defender whose contract runs until 2026, is in contract renewal talks influenced by coaching changes, and he is expected to feature in the upcoming FIFA Club World Cup due to injuries in the right-back position. Rodrygo, who has struggled with form since February and faced rumors of departure amid interest from English clubs, has expressed his desire to remain at Real Madrid, but the club expects him to prove his value on the pitch, particularly during the Club World Cup period. Despite support from the coaching staff and executives, Rodrygo has approximately 45 days to demonstrate his readiness under Alonso’s leadership. Meanwhile, midfielder Dani Ceballos, linked with possible exit rumors, is confirmed to stay as a crucial part of Madrid's midfield rebuild; Alonso sees him as a potential leader due to his tactical intelligence and versatility. The Club World Cup represents a key opportunity for these players to solidify their roles in Real Madrid’s evolving squad.
